HOUSE BILL 1193
AN ACT relative to chartered public school fees and enrollment policies.
ANALYSIS
This bill clarifies the prohibition on application fees for chartered public schools and the preference for in-state students for enrollment.

STATE OF NEW HAMPSHIRE
In the Year of Our Lord Two Thousand Twenty Two
AN ACT relative to chartered public school fees and enrollment policies.
Be it Enacted by the Senate and House of Representatives in General Court convened:
1 Chartered Public Schools; Admission. Amend RSA 194-B:2, III to read as follows:
III. There shall be no application fee for pupil admission to any chartered public school, and any non-application fees to be charged to students shall not be assessed as a condition for enrollment.
2 New Subparagraph; Charted Public Schools; Enrollment. Amend RSA 194-B:9, I(c) by inserting after subparagraph (3) the following new subparagraph:
(4) If a chartered public school accepts out-of-state students, preference shall be given to in-state students in determination of the chartered public school's maximum published enrollment prior to any lottery selection pursuant to this subparagraph.
3 Effective Date. This act shall take effect upon its passage.
